### CMake options
ENABLE_CURSES=ON - Build with (n)curses; Enables a server side terminal (command line option: --terminal)
ENABLE_FREETYPE=ON - Build with FreeType2; Allows using TTF fonts
ENABLE_GETTEXT=ON - Build with Gettext; Allows using translations
- ENABLE_GLES=OFF - Build for OpenGL ES instead of OpenGL (requires support by Irrlicht)
+ ENABLE_GLES=OFF - Build for OpenGL ES instead of OpenGL (requires support by IrrlichtMt)
ENABLE_LEVELDB=ON - Build with LevelDB; Enables use of LevelDB map backend
ENABLE_POSTGRESQL=ON - Build with libpq; Enables use of PostgreSQL map backend (PostgreSQL 9.5 or greater recommended)
ENABLE_REDIS=ON - Build with libhiredis; Enables use of Redis map backend
